This news item is about: In the chilly days between two snowstorms and windy weather, the Cornell Equine Park saw its first foal of 2018 born last week. Moe, a 10-year-old mare, delivered foal Tigger on March 9. ’ve had a foal born at the equine park each of the past three years,” said Moe’s owner Linda Mastellar. “It’s a great comfort to know that they are closely monitored.” Anna Mitchell, theriogenology resident with the College of Veterinary Medicine, described Tigger as a strong foal at birth. “He was quick to stand and nurse, and he’s continued to be a fast learner,” she said.
